batch
definitions
Cambridge | Wiktionary | Weblio | OED | Images | Youglish
notes
- Obsolete meaning “the process of baking” <- Old English bacan (to bake) -> whence English bake
quell
definitions
Cambridge | Wiktionary | Weblio | OED | Images | Youglish
notes
- possibly related to English kill (arguably via Old English cwellan (to kill)), but the OED says it is difficult to explain, since the corresponding word for kill is not found in the cognate languages
